2025年值得关注的高质量开源项目推荐
本文精选了2025年值得关注的20个高质量开源项目,涵盖AI、Web、IoT和教育工具等多个领域。AI方向推荐claude-code、diffusers等项目;Web领域包括evershop、lobe-chat等框架;实用工具有Bun运行时、MinerU数据提取工具等;此外还有ESP32物联网项目和教育类资源。这些项目均提供GitHub地址和功能简介,适合不同层次的开发者参考学习。作者建议初学者从
🔥 2025年值得关注的高质量开源项目推荐(含GitHub地址与简介)
👋 大家好,我是一名个人开发者,平时喜欢研究各种优秀的开源项目。最近在整理资料时,我发现了许多有意思、实用且活跃的仓库,涵盖 AI、Web、IoT、教育工具等多个方向。
本文特地整理了 20 个值得关注的项目,帮助想深入学习或找灵感的开发者少走弯路。
所有内容均为公开项目简介和功能概述,符合 CSDN 文章规范,无涉审内容。
🧠 人工智能与大模型方向
1. claude-code
- 作者:anthropics
- 地址:https://github.com/anthropics/claude-code
- 简介:由 Anthropic 团队推出的代码增强工具,专注于智能编程与自动补全。支持多种语言,通过自然语言理解来生成、分析或优化代码。
2. claude-code-templates
- 作者:davila7
- 地址:https://github.com/davila7/claude-code-templates
- 简介:提供 Claude AI 在软件工程中的模板示例,包括自动化测试、代码生成、文档生成等,方便开发者快速上手。
3. spring-ai-alibaba
- 作者:alibaba
- 地址:https://github.com/alibaba/spring-ai-alibaba
- 简介:阿里巴巴推出的 Spring AI 集成框架,支持大模型调用与企业级部署,面向 Java 开发者的 AI 服务解决方案。
4. diffusers
- 作者:huggingface
- 地址:https://github.com/huggingface/diffusers
- 简介:Hugging Face 官方的扩散模型库,支持 Stable Diffusion、SDXL 等生成模型,广泛用于图像生成与研究。
5. klavis
- 作者:Klavis-AI
- 地址:https://github.com/Klavis-AI/klavis
- 简介:一个多模态 AI 框架,整合语音、文本和图像处理能力,专注于知识理解与多模态推理。
🌐 Web 与前端方向
6. evershop
- 作者:evershopcommerce
- 地址:https://github.com/evershopcommerce/evershop
- 简介:一款现代化的电商框架,基于 Node.js 与 React 构建,开箱即用的前后端一体化解决方案。
7. lobe-chat
- 作者:lobehub
- 地址:https://github.com/lobehub/lobe-chat
- 简介:一个支持多模型、多账户的聊天应用,前端使用 Next.js 构建,UI 简洁,支持自部署和本地存储。
8. coze-studio
- 作者:coze-dev
- 地址:https://github.com/coze-dev/coze-studio
- 简介:一体化的工作流与 Bot 开发平台,可视化设计智能体逻辑,适合初学者和自动化开发者使用。
9. daytona
- 作者:daytonaio
- 地址:https://github.com/daytonaio/daytona
- 简介:一个跨平台的开发环境管理器,用于快速搭建和同步本地与远程开发环境,类似 GitHub Codespaces 的开源替代方案。
10. omarchy
- 作者:basecamp
- 地址:https://github.com/basecamp/omarchy
- 简介:由 Basecamp 团队开源的轻量化架构实验项目,关注简单、清晰和易维护的 Web 应用设计模式。
🧰 实用工具与系统开发
11. bun
- 作者:oven-sh
- 地址:https://github.com/oven-sh/bun
- 简介:一个高性能的 JavaScript 运行时,兼容 Node.js,内置打包、测试与依赖管理工具,性能极强。
12. MinerU
- 作者:opendatalab
- 地址:https://github.com/opendatalab/MinerU
- 简介:开源的通用信息提取框架,支持 PDF、网页、文档等结构化提取,是数据标注与知识挖掘领域的重要工具。
13. ticket-purchase
- 作者:WECENG
- 地址:https://github.com/WECENG/ticket-purchase
- 简介:一个基于 Spring Boot + Vue 的购票系统示例项目,完整演示前后端分离架构和订单逻辑。
14. winboat
- 作者:TibixDev
- 地址:https://github.com/TibixDev/winboat
- 简介:轻量级 Windows 调整工具,支持任务栏、资源管理器、主题自定义等,适合桌面爱好者使用。
🪐 嵌入式与教育项目
15. xiaozhi-esp32
- 作者:78
- 地址:https://github.com/78/xiaozhi-esp32
- 简介:基于 ESP32 的智能语音机器人项目,整合语音识别、Wi-Fi 控制与云端交互,适合物联网学习者。
16. ChinaTextbook
- 作者:TapXWorld
- 地址:https://github.com/TapXWorld/ChinaTextbook
- 简介:一个旨在整理公开教材资源的项目,用于教育研究与教学参考,支持多学科内容整理。
17. Everywhere
- 作者:DearVa
- 地址:https://github.com/DearVa/Everywhere
- 简介:多平台同步工具,支持文件、笔记与任务管理的云同步方案,界面简洁,兼容移动端。
18. HowToCook
- 作者:Anduin2017
- 地址:https://github.com/Anduin2017/HowToCook
- 简介:一个风靡社区的开源项目,用编程语言的思维来写菜谱,幽默又实用,适合程序员自我调侃放松。
19. RSSHub
- 作者:DIYgod
- 地址:https://github.com/DIYgod/RSSHub
- 简介:强大的 RSS 生成器,支持从各类网站动态生成订阅源,是自动化与信息聚合的利器。
20. Cubyz
- 作者:PixelGuys
- 地址:https://github.com/PixelGuys/Cubyz
- 简介:一个体素(Voxel)风格的 3D 沙盒游戏引擎,完全开源,可二次开发,适合想学习图形渲染与游戏引擎架构的开发者。
📚 总结与思考
这些项目覆盖了从 AI 框架、Web 工具、系统优化到嵌入式开发 的多个领域。
我建议如果你是初学者,可以从 evershop、winboat、HowToCook 这样的项目入手;
如果你想深入 AI 或系统方向,不妨研究 spring-ai-alibaba、bun、diffusers 等项目的架构与源码。
我个人在学习过程中经常通过阅读源码和文档,反向分析架构设计思路,这比单纯看教程更能提升能力。
希望这份整理能给你一些灵感 ✨。
📮 结语
如果你也在研究类似的开源项目,或者有好的仓库推荐,欢迎在评论区交流!
记得点个赞 👍 支持一下,让更多开发者看到这些优质资源。
魔乐社区(Modelers.cn) 是一个中立、公益的人工智能社区,提供人工智能工具、模型、数据的托管、展示与应用协同服务,为人工智能开发及爱好者搭建开放的学习交流平台。社区通过理事会方式运作,由全产业链共同建设、共同运营、共同享有,推动国产AI生态繁荣发展。
更多推荐


所有评论(0)